Abstract
This paper studies the problems of stability analysis and Hâ controller synthesis of switched systems with time-varying delay based on an input-output approach. The attention is focused on developing a new method to further reduce the conservatism of the existing results. The system under consideration is transformed into an interconnection system, and the scaled small gain condition for the interconnection systems is introduced. Based on the system transformation and the scaled small gain theorem, an improved delay-dependent stability criterion is proposed such that the interconnection system is asymptotically stable, which is also proved to guarantee the asymptotic stability of the system based on the direct Lyapunov method in another perspective. The proposed stability condition is demonstrated to be less conservative than most existing results. Moreover, an admissible controller, which solves the problem of Hâ controller synthesis, is formulated into a convex optimization problem. Illustrative examples are provided to show the advantage and the effectiveness of the proposed method.
